一、下载Git
在开始使用Git之前,首先需要在本地电脑上下载并安装Git。根据自己的操作系统选择相应的版本进行下载,可以在Git官网上找到相应的安装包。
下载完成后,按照指引进行安装即可。
注意:
在Windows操作系统上安装Git时,需要选择将Git添加到系统的PATH环境变量中。这样才能够在命令行中直接使用Git命令。
如果是Mac或Linux操作系统,则无需进行操作。
二、在本地创建一个代码仓库
1. 创建文件夹
在本地电脑上选择一个文件夹作为我们的代码仓库。可以在桌面、文档或其他地方创建一个文件夹。
打开命令行或终端,进入这个文件夹。
cd path/to/your/folder
说明:
在命令行中,cd
命令可以切换到指定的目录中。
path/to/your/folder
是你自己的文件夹路径。注意,在Windows系统下,路径中的\
需要改为/
。
2. 初始化Git仓库
在创建好的文件夹中初始化Git仓库。
git init
说明:
git init
命令可以在当前目录下创建一个空的Git仓库。在该目录下会生成.git
文件夹,这个文件夹是Git用来跟踪管理版本的核心。
三、将代码添加到仓库中
在Git仓库中,修改的文件需要通过git add
命令添加到Git的“暂存区”(Staging Area)中,再通过git commit
命令提交到Git的“本地仓库”(Local Repository)中。
1. 添加文件到暂存区
在文件夹中新建一个文件,比如命名为file.txt
。
使用git add
命令将文件添加到暂存区中。
git add file.txt
说明:
在使用git add
命令时,可以指定一个或多个文件、目录来添加。比如将目录下的所有文件都添加到暂存区,可以使用下面的命令:
git add .
其中的.
表示当前目录下的所有文件。
2. 提交修改到本地仓库
使用git commit
命令将修改提交到本地仓库中。
git commit -m "commit message"
说明:
在提交前需要写一个提交信息,告诉其他人或自己这个提交是做了什么事情,可以通过-m
参数来指定提交信息。比如:
git commit -m "add file.txt"
这个提交信息描述了这次提交的内容是添加了一个名为file.txt
的文件。
四、与远程仓库建立连接并推送代码
在将代码提交到本地仓库之后,还需要把代码推送到远程仓库中,以便与其他人协作工作。
1. 连接远程仓库
在与远程仓库协作时,需要先将本地仓库与远程仓库建立联系。
使用git remote add
命令来关联远程仓库。
比如,关联GitHub上的一个远程仓库:
git remote add origin https://github.com/user/repo.git
说明:
origin
是关联的远程仓库的别名。在后面的操作中就可以使用这个别名来代表这个远程仓库。
2. 将本地仓库推送到远程仓库
在关联好远程仓库之后,再将本地仓库中的代码推送到远程仓库中。
使用git push
命令来推送代码。
git push -u origin master
说明:
在第一次推送代码时,需要使用-u
参数将本地仓库与远程仓库关联起来。之后的推送就可以直接使用命令git push
进行操作即可。
master
表示本地仓库中的主分支,origin
表示远程仓库的别名。如果之前关联时使用的是其他名字,这里也需要相应地进行替换。
五、从远程仓库中拉取代码
当其他人对远程仓库中的代码进行了修改,我们需要从远程仓库中将这些修改拉取到本地。
使用git pull
命令来拉取远程仓库中的代码。
git pull
说明:
如果本地仓库和远程仓库都有新的修改,这个命令会先将远程仓库中的修改拉取到本地,然后再进行合并。如果有冲突,则需要手动解决冲突。
六、总结
到此为止,我们已经完成了一个基本的Git操作流程。我们先下载并安装了Git,然后在本地创建了一个空的Git仓库,并将代码添加到仓库中,并push到远程仓库中。最后,我们还学习了如何从远程仓库中拉取代码到本地仓库中。
Git是一个非常强大的版本控制工具,掌握好它的使用,可以让我们更加高效地协作开发,提高工作效率。